Johannes Neumann presents a new hypothesis on the emergence of the human mind. The idea: The brains of people in a social group work together as a network - like computer networks. The human mind emerged from the network communication of early groups of people.
Johannes Neumann, born in 1949, studied Protestant theology, history, and business administration; from 1993 to 2019 he ran an auditing and tax consulting firm in Radebeul near Dresden.
